If you’re like me, you have a keyring full of look-alike-keys with no clue in telling which one is the house key or the storage key.  Annoying right? Not to mention that at nighttime it’s even more difficult to tell them apart.  I’m sure you’re already hip to the PVC/ leather keycap trend to solve this issue, but what do you do when those caps get worn and torn off?  Lose money buying another pack?  I think not.  That can all be avoided because I discovered something that’s durable, unique, and a lot less costly in the end.

To keep you from constantly spending money on keycaps, opt into painting your keys with nail polish.  This solution made me very happy because I own a lot of it and I’m sure you do too! Lucky us! 😀  So here you are, an easy, thrifty way to customize your keys without the hassle of fussing with thick, rigid keycaps. Yay!

As you can see in the B/A photos above, your keys look sleeker and more stylish than those bulky caps.  Plus, you can design them however you want.  Your imagination sets the stage for your designs, whether you want your keys to be glittery, neon, pastel, glow-in-the-dark, etc.

Spring Quencher: Raspberry-Mango Sangria

Yield: Serves 8

Ingredients

  • 1 mango, peeled, pitted, flesh thinly sliced lengthwise
  • 1 cup raspberries
  • 3 tablespoons raspberry liqueur
  • 1 bottle (750 ml) rose wine
  • 4 cups (32 ounces) chilled lemon-lime soda
  • Ice

Directions

  1. In a pitcher or large bowl, combine mango, raspberries, raspberry liqueur, and rose wine.
  2. Stir to combine and refrigerate 1 hour (or up to overnight). To serve, add lemon-lime soda and ice.

Spring Treats: Watermelon Jell-O Petites

bela_hello-jello2

Yield: Makes 20 fruit slices

Ingredients

  • 1 cup boiling water
  • 1 (3-ounce) pkg. strawberry-flavored gelatin
  • 1 cup chopped fresh OR frozen* strawberries (*thawed )
  • 1/2 cup cold water
  • 5 limes, halved, pulp scooped out & discarded, AND rind halves reserved
  • 1 teaspoon black sesame seeds, poppy seeds, or basil seeds

Directions

  1. Slice the fruit cleanly in half lengthwise (through the axis).
  2. Carefully remove the pulp while keeping the half rind fully intact.
  3. Ensure that the rinds are dry (you can use paper towels to blot them).
  4. Set each half rind upright in a muffin pan so you can fill it with Jello.
  5. Mix the water with the gelatin (just like you would to make jigglers).
  6. You’ll want the Jell-O a little firmer than the normal recipe as you have to slice it in half again.
  7. Make sure that the gelatin is well dissolved, and then pour into the fruit before it begins to set.
  8. Fill up as high as you can; the Jell-O will shrink a bit when cooling.
  9. Carefully transfer to the fridge and let set for about three hours, per box directions.
  10. When the Jello is set, place the fruit open-side down on a cutting board, hold it’s shape with one hand and carefully slice in half lengthwise again to form quarters.
  11. Be careful not to smash the fruit as you’ll want to keep the Jello intact (you may use a serrated knife).
